Prioritize the Processor Over Everything Else
Think of your CPU as the lead singer of your production setup; if they can’t hit the notes, the whole performance falls apart. When you’re layering tracks or running heavy virtual instruments, your processor is doing the heavy lifting. You want a multi-core processor because your DAW (Digital Audio Workstation) distributes the workload across those cores. If you settle for a weak chip, you’ll experience that dreaded audio crackling—the sound of your computer literally gasping for air. This is why the best laptops for sound designers and music producers emphasize high clock speeds and multiple threads. RAM is Your Digital Workspace
If the CPU is the chef, RAM is the size of the kitchen counter. If you only have 8GB, you’re working on a cutting board; 16GB gives you the whole island. This is especially vital for the best laptops for heavy multi-tasking. When you load a massive sample library like Kontakt, it lives in your RAM. If you run out of space, the computer starts swapping data to the hard drive, and that’s when your session grinds to a halt. Connectivity Without the Dongle Drama
In a studio, your laptop is the hub of a massive wheel. You have audio interfaces, MIDI keyboards, and external SSDs all fighting for a spot. Using a cheap hub is a recipe for ground loop hum and disconnected hardware mid-set. Always check for laptops with the best ports for studio setups to ensure you have dedicated USB and Thunderbolt connections. Why Your 4K Screen Might Actually Be Lying to You
It is incredibly easy to get sucked into ‘4K’ marketing, but high resolution is actually secondary to color accuracy for serious work. If you are producing content for clients, understanding why your laptop screen lies to you about color is non-negotiable. I once edited an entire commercial on a ‘vibrant’ gaming display only to realize later that the skin tones looked like radioactive oranges on every other device. You need a panel rated for at least 100% sRGB or DCI-P3, not just a high pixel count. This is a common pitfall when browsing best editing laptops for serious creators.

How do I maintain peak performance as my laptop gets older?
The secret to a long-lasting machine is a combination of physical care and strict software hygiene. I see so many creators leaving fifty browser tabs and twenty startup applications running in the background while they try to edit 10-bit footage. This is digital suicide for your workflow. Every quarter, I perform a ‘factory-fresh’ audit where I purge temporary cache files and migrate completed projects to external cold storage. If you are constantly fighting for disk space, knowing how to manage 100gb video files on a portable editing laptop will keep your internal NVMe drive from hitting that performance-killing ‘red bar’ of death. When an SSD is nearly full, its write speeds can drop significantly, which directly impacts your real-time playback and render times. I also highly recommend looking into advanced thermal management. According to the technical deep-dives at NotebookCheck, even high-end thermal paste can experience ‘pump-out’ or drying over 18 to 24 months of heavy usage, so keeping an eye on your baseline temperatures is vital for long-term health.
